They have views of the Rhine, the pier, the romantic castles Rheinstein and Breitenstein, the Schweizerhaus and Germany berühmtester Pinot Noir able to Assmann Höllenberg. The apartment is located in the former Hotel Anker, which was rebuilt after extensive renovation measures in a luxury apartment block. At the very oldest engravings of Assmannshausen from 1723 the silhouette of Eismauerhäuschen be seen. After access through the lobby of the 'anchor' can be reached by stairs or change easily by elevator, the location on the 1st floor about 50 square meters apartment. It consists of a bedroom, a living room with a comfortable sofa bed, bathroom with bathtub and a spacious dining room with kitchenette. The exposed jewelry framework, the wooden floor, the stylist furniture and Art Nouveau tiles in the bathroom give the apartment a cozy character. It offers an unforgettable view from the living room and bedroom on the Rhine and the passing ships, from the dining room look directly onto the Höllenberg. You have only a few meters from the butcher and a small grocery store. In the immediate vicinity, many excellent restaurants, wine cellars and bars. The ferry dock the Rössler Line for trips to Rudesheim, Bingen, Koblenz, etc. are right outside the door. Wiesbaden and Mainz can be reached in 25 minutes by car or by train to Frankfurt airport is about 40 minutes.More
